Stability of SIRS Epidemic Model with Stochastic Perturbation and Distributed Delays release_kuwvqgsc3fghnorm3a4ecfb7ya

by Ramziya Rifhat, Xamxinur Abdurahman, Ahmadjan Muhammadhaji

Published in ISRN Applied Mathematics by Hindawi Limited.

2013   Volume 2013, p1-6

Abstract

A class of SIRS epidemic model with stochastic perturbation and distributed delays is proposed and discussed. Some sufficient conditions on the stability of the zero solution are established. Finally, concluding that, the white noise is favorable for the stability of zero solution and the distributed time delays have no impact on the stability of zero solution.
